Readers praise this book for its rich exploration of the March sisters' lives as they transition into adulthood, navigating personal growth, maturity, and the complexities of young womanhood. Many found the narrative to offer valuable life lessons on themes such as family, love, marriage, grief, and duty, prompting self-reflection and personal improvement. The prose is often described as beautiful, warm, and engaging, with some readers finding it less moralistic and more mature than the previous installment. The individual character development, particularly for Amy, is noted as a highlight, showing transformation and adaptation to societal expectations. The enduring bond between the sisters and their mother continues to resonate, providing comfort and timeless wisdom for many who re-read the story multiple times.
Conversely, a significant portion of readers expressed profound disappointment, finding the book a stark departure from the charm and idealism of the first part. There was widespread frustration with the character trajectories, especially for a beloved main character whose professional and personal choices were seen as a betrayal of her independent spirit and original aspirations. Many felt let down by the romantic developments, with unexpected pairings and a perceived lack of authenticity in certain relationships. Reviewers also criticized the book for its outdated societal views on women's roles, which some found pretentious or frustrating, depicting female characters as giving up their passions or being burdened by marital expectations. The pacing was sometimes described as slow, boring, or plodding, leading to a loss of engagement and, for some, regret at having read it.
Ultimately, opinions on this book are sharply divided. While some readers cherish its portrayal of the March sisters' maturation and the profound life lessons it offers on family, duty, and resilience, others find it a disheartening continuation of the beloved first installment. It appeals to those who appreciate a more realistic and nuanced exploration of adulthood, societal pressures, and the compromises characters may face as they grow older, even when these paths diverge from youthful dreams. However, readers seeking a purely idealistic or conventionally romantic resolution, or those deeply invested in specific character aspirations from the first book, may find this sequel disappointing or even a source of heartache.
